Isononyl acetate

CH3C00(CH2)2CH(CH3)CH2C(CH3)3, C11H22O2, Mr 186.29, does not occur in nature. Commercial isononyl acetate contains small amounts of by-products. It is a colorless liquid with a woody-fruity odor and is prepared from diisobutene by the 0x0 synthesis, followed by hydrogenation to the alcohol and acetylation. It is used in household perfumery. [Pg.19]

Polymer plasticization can be achieved either through internal or external incorporation of the plasticizer into the polymer. Internal plasticization involves copolymerization of the monomers of the desired polymer and that of the plasticizer so that the plasticizer is an integral part of the polymer chain. In this case, the plasticizer is usually a polymer with a low Tg. The most widely used internal plasticizer monomers are vinyl acetate and vinylidene chloride. External plasticizers are those incorporated into the resin as an external additive. Typical low-molecular-weight external plasticizers for PVC are esters formed from the reaction of acids or acid anhydrides with alcohols. The acids include ortho- and iso-or terephthalic, benzoic, and trimellitic acids, which are cyclic or adipic, azeleic, sebacic, and phosphoric acids, which are linear. The alcohol may be monohydric such as 2-ethylhexanol, butanol, or isononyl alcohol or polyhydric such as ethylene or propylene glycol. Fig. 13.1 Polymers used for medical devices for dialysis and peritoneal dialysis. Polyurethane (PUR) is applied as potting material for capillary membranes, silicone tings guarantee a leak-age-free system, polycarbonate and polypropylene are used for casings, and a series of polymers are incorporated as membrane materials (P5M-polysulfone, P S-polyether-sulfone, PA-polyamide, PAAf-polyacrylonitrile, PMMA-polymethylmethacrylate, CIA-cellulose-tri-acetate). PUC-polyvinylchloride as a biomaterial for tubing needs plasticizers for its flexibility, such as D 7/P/DOP-di-ethyl-hexylphthalate/di-octyl-phthalate, TOTM-tn-octyl trimeUitate, DWCif-di-isononyl-cyclohexane...
